KANSAS Fabric 205 g/m2
Versatile fabric for workwear and medical clothing
KANSAS 205 g/m² fabric is a proven material designed for the production of workwear with a wide range of applications. It is perfect for summer clothing, aprons, and insulated garments. In its white version, thanks to its soft finish and high washing temperature resistance, it is ideal for the food industry and medical clothing.
Key Advantages of KANSAS 205 g/m² Fabric:
- Durability against friction and mechanical damage – ensures durability and long-lasting use, even in demanding work conditions.
- Low Shrinkage – the fabric in white color retains its dimensions and shape after washing at temperatures up to 95°C, which is especially important in the food and medical industries.
- Color Fastness – the colors remain vibrant and resistant to fading, ensuring the long-lasting aesthetics of the clothing.
- Possibility of Combining Colors – without the risk of shade variation, allowing for the creation of cohesive and attractive clothing designs.
- Comfort in Use – the material ensures all-day wearing comfort, which is crucial for work.
Compliance with standards:
KANSAS 205 g/m² fabric meets the most important standards for protective clothing:
- PN-P-84525 - guaranteeing the appropriate quality of the material.
- PN-EN ISO 13688 - protective clothing – general requirements.

Fabric Parameters:
Weight | 205 g/m2 |
---|---|
Kolor | #016e5b, #2d2d2f, #2e3349, #355749, #495fa8, #52555a, #bd2a3d, #f0f1ec |
Composition | 65% polyester, 35% cotton |
Width | 150 cm |
Washing Temperature | 60 Celsius degrees |
